Output 66676d78e1a33a624f180ec4386240a403cbddaa2e5474bab7b4aa26306f2281:10

value
3168241
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c7f3865bdbc51ae4b7b2c1f5bfdf950f7bbe1bd OP_EQUAL
address
3Qi6cJjeopTuAWqqPGEEe2BLc74EatodDQ
transaction
66676d78e1a33a624f180ec4386240a403cbddaa2e5474bab7b4aa26306f2281
spent
true